Know before you go

Hi, I'm Eve. Here are a few practical things to know before exploring Bassin Bleu.

Local know-how to help you travel smarter and make the most of every moment.

Wear comfortable shoes for the hike to the falls and be prepared for some uneven terrain.
Bring a waterproof camera to capture the stunning views and your adventures in the water.
Visit early in the morning to avoid crowds and enjoy a peaceful experience.
Pack a picnic to enjoy by the pools and make a day of your visit.
Check local weather conditions before your visit, as heavy rains can affect accessibility.

Discover more about Bassin Bleu

Nestled in the picturesque hills of Jacmel, Bassin Bleu is a breathtaking natural wonder that beckons travelers with its stunning blue waters and lush tropical scenery. This enchanting destination is renowned for its series of cascading waterfalls and natural pools that provide an idyllic setting for swimming and relaxation. The vibrant turquoise waters, surrounded by verdant foliage, create a postcard-perfect backdrop, making it a favorite spot for photographers and nature lovers alike. Visitors can enjoy a refreshing dip in the cool waters, explore the surrounding trails, or simply bask in the tranquility of this stunning location. The journey to Bassin Bleu is as rewarding as the destination itself. Adventurous travelers will appreciate the scenic hike through the lush Haitian landscape, where the sound of cascading water guides you along the way. As you approach the falls, the anticipation builds, and the sight of the shimmering pools invites you to take a plunge. The atmosphere is serene, with the natural beauty providing a perfect escape from the hustle and bustle of everyday life. Bassin Bleu is not just a place to swim; it’s an experience that engages the senses. The lush greenery, the sound of water splashing, and the fresh scent of nature create a soothing ambiance that invites visitors to unwind. Whether you’re looking to connect with nature, enjoy a picnic, or capture stunning photos, Bassin Bleu offers an unforgettable experience that should not be missed when visiting Jacmel.
